深入探讨V2Ray KcpSettings配置及使用指南

在当今网络环境中,使用代理工具已经成为许多人日常上网的一部分。其中,V2Ray是一款强大的网络代理工具,它能够帮助用户实现科学上网。而KcpSettings作为V2Ray的重要配置项之一,更是帮助用户提高网络连接速度和稳定性的关键。本文将深入探讨V2Ray的KcpSettings,指导用户如何进行有效配置和使用。

什么是V2Ray?

V2Ray是一个功能强大的网络代理工具,具有灵活的配置和广泛的应用场景。它支持多种传输协议和网络架构,能够有效突破网络限制。用户通过V2Ray,可以实现高速、安全的网络访问。

KcpSettings的定义

KcpSettings是V2Ray中的一个重要配置部分,主要用于调整KCP协议的相关参数。KCP是一种用于网络传输的协议,专门设计用来解决TCP的延迟和丢包问题。通过优化KcpSettings,用户可以获得更好的网络性能和更高的连接稳定性。

KcpSettings的配置项

1. MTU(最大传输单元)

  • MTU指的是每个数据包的最大字节数,适当设置可以减少数据包的分片。
  • 建议值:1400~1500,具体值需要根据网络情况进行调整。

2. Tti(传输时间间隔)

  • TTI是KCP在没有数据传输时的等待时间,单位是毫秒。
  • 建议值:20~50,较低的值可以提升响应速度。

3. UTP(未确认数据包的超时)

  • 用于控制KCP对未确认数据包的处理时间,单位是毫秒。
  • 建议值:200~300,确保连接稳定性。

4. WriteBufferSize(写缓存大小)

  • 控制KCP传输的写入缓存大小,单位是字节。
  • 建议值:32768,适当提高可以提高数据传输速度。

5. ReadBufferSize(读缓存大小)

  • 控制KCP传输的读取缓存大小,单位是字节。
  • 建议值:32768,确保数据读取顺畅。

KcpSettings的优化技巧

为了获得更佳的网络体验,用户可以采取以下优化策略:

  • 根据网络情况调整参数:不同网络环境下,MTU和TTI的最佳值可能会有所不同,用户应根据实际情况进行测试和调整。
  • 定期检查网络性能:使用网络测速工具,定期检查上传、下载速度及延迟情况。
  • 使用最新版本的V2Ray:保持V2Ray的版本更新,利用新版本中的优化和修复。
  • 多尝试不同配置:KcpSettings的配置并没有固定答案,建议用户多尝试不同的组合,以找到最适合自己的设置。

常见问题解答(FAQ)

1. V2Ray的KcpSettings与其他设置有什么区别?

  • KcpSettings主要专注于KCP协议的参数优化,而其他设置可能涉及不同的协议或功能。优化KcpSettings有助于提高在高延迟或丢包环境下的网络表现。

2. 如何判断KcpSettings的配置是否合理?

  • 通过网络测速工具检查连接速度、延迟和丢包率,合理的配置应能降低延迟、减少丢包,提升下载和上传速度。

3. V2Ray KcpSettings的默认值是什么?

  • 不同版本的V2Ray可能默认值有所不同,通常可以在配置文件中查看,用户可以根据实际需求进行修改。

4. 我可以通过修改KcpSettings解决我的网络慢的问题吗?

  • 适当调整KcpSettings可以改善网络性能,但不一定能解决所有问题,用户也需检查其他可能影响速度的因素,如ISP的限制。

5. 如何找到适合自己的KcpSettings配置?

  • 最佳方法是通过不断测试,记录不同配置下的网络性能,找到最适合自己的参数组合。

总结

V2Ray的KcpSettings是提升网络性能的重要工具,通过合理配置,用户可以有效改善网络速度和稳定性。希望本文能够帮助您更好地理解和使用V2Ray的KcpSettings,实现更流畅的上网体验。

正文完